Entergy (ELC) represents a collateral trust mortgage bond issuance by Entergy Louisiana, Inc., carrying a fixed coupon of 4.875% with a scheduled maturity date of September 1, 2066. As a fixed-income security, this instrument operates differently from common equity offerings, serving as a long-term debt obligation backed by the utility's assets and revenue streams. **No recent earnings data available** for this bond security. Management Commentary

Entergy Louisiana operates as part of the larger Entergy Corporation network, which provides electricity to customers across Louisiana, Arkansas, Mississippi, and Texas. As a regulated utility, the company operates under oversight from state utility commissions, which significantly influences its financial structure and operational decisions. Bondholders in collateral trust mortgage securities maintain a priority claim on specific assets of the issuing utility. This structural protection provides an additional layer of security beyond general corporate obligations. The 4.875% coupon rate reflects market conditions at the time of issuance, offering fixed-income investors a specified return over the bond's extended duration. Credit rating agencies periodically assess Entergy Louisiana's financial health, examining factors including regulatory environment stability, capital expenditure requirements, and the company's ability to generate sufficient cash flow to service debt obligations. These assessments directly impact investor perceptions of the bond's risk profile and its trading value in secondary markets. Forward Guidance

For investors considering ELC bonds, several factors merit attention in the current market environment. The extended maturity date of 2066 means holders face significant interest rate risk over the bond's remaining life. Should market interest rates rise substantially, the fixed 4.875% coupon may become less attractive relative to newly issued securities, potentially resulting in price depreciation. Regulatory developments in the utility sector continue to shape the operating landscape for companies like Entergy Louisiana. Rate case proceedings, infrastructure investment requirements, and evolving clean energy mandates all influence the financial trajectory of regulated utilities and, consequently, their capacity to honor long-term debt obligations. The utility sector has demonstrated relative resilience during periods of economic uncertainty, as electricity demand typically remains stable regardless of broader economic conditions. This characteristic provides some defensive positioning for utility bond investors compared to more cyclically sensitive industries. Market Reaction

Trading activity for long-dated utility bonds reflects ongoing adjustments to monetary policy expectations and evolving risk assessments across fixed-income markets. The extended duration characteristic of bonds with maturities extending several decades makes them particularly sensitive to changes in the interest rate environment. Investors evaluating ELC bonds should consider their portfolio positioning objectives, whether seeking current income, duration exposure, or defensive characteristics. The 4.875% coupon provides a fixed return stream, though its competitiveness depends on comparisons with prevailing market rates for similar credit quality instruments. Portfolio managers often utilize utility bonds for income generation and diversification purposes, given the sector's historically lower correlation with equity market movements. However, the extended maturity profile requires careful assessment of interest rate outlook and total return potential. The collateral trust mortgage structure of ELC provides investors with a defined claim on specific utility assets, distinguishing it from unsecured debt obligations. This structural feature may appeal to investors prioritizing downside protection and predictable income streams over maximum yield potential.
